Wide-ranging frequencies are employed by cellular towers to provide speech and data. The coverage section of low frequency transmissions, such as those at 600 MHz and 700 MHz, is bigger than that of high frequency broadcasts. For example, a cell tower operating at 2.5 GHz frequencies has a 3 mile or more coverage area. But a cell tower operating at 3.5 GHz C-band frequencies can only distribute its signal for roughly a mile.
More cells must be installed in urban centers for cellular networks to operate more efficiently. They need to construct additional cell towers and see them closer together to get this done. 4. The Distance Between You and the Tower
There's fear that additional cell towers will undoubtedly be required once the mobile network switches to 5G. This is because the 5G network will run at higher frequencies, and higher frequency waves have a far more difficult time bouncing from hills, trees, and other obstructions. As a consequence, cell towers must be considerably closer together than in past technological eras, increasing the number of transmitters around you all the time.
The issue is that a lot of people mistake tiny cells for 5G cell towers. Small cells, which are commonly installed on utility poles or light poles, are really antennas that function together with giant macro-towers to create wireless networks. Because of their closeness to residences and businesses, even though they aren't thought of as being a element of a cellular phone tower, some individuals mistakenly think that they represent 5G technology.
